German eBay hacker arrested

By

Police have arrested a 19 year-old German hacker who claims he managed to control the local domain of eBay.

Reports state that the teenager redirected German auction-goers from the ebay.de site to a different domain name server with a  
technique he stumbled accross on the internet.


He later tried the redirection technique on other websites including web.de, google.de and amazon.de.

eBay was unavailable to comment on the matter.
